Master of Arts in Christian Spirituality

Graduation Credits 24 │ Part-time 4-yr
 

Program Purpose

The Master of Arts in Christian Spirituality degree is to equip pastors and Christian leaders in the ministries of spiritual formation.

 

Program Goals

  • Foundational knowledge on Christian spirituality based on Scripture, Church tradition and theology. Insight from human sciences, particularly the discipline of psychology, is also employed to enrich the understanding of human life and experience.
  • Experiential learning to grasp the transformational dynamic in spiritual formation.
  • Critical theological reflection and integration of knowledge and experience.
  • Effective application of knowledge and skills in one’s ministry context.

 

Admission Requirements

  • A bachelor’s degree or equivalent from an institution recognized by LTS; and
  • Four prerequisite courses (12 credits) in the area of biblical or systematic theologies recognized by LTS; otherwise, admitted students should fulfill the requirement via the course at LTS on an extra-credit basis.

 

Program Content

The program, which is an integration of academic study, experimental learning and ministry application, includes 3 core courses, 3 guided electives, plus 2 free electives, for a total of 24 credits. Students are required to pay extra fees for retreats apart from the tuition.

 

Further Study

If a Master of Arts in Christian Spirituality degree holder continues to study for the Master of Divinity (M.Div.3-yr) at LTS, a maximum of 12 credits can be exempted. If the holder also has a B.Th. degree, s/he can continue to study for the Master of Divinity (M.Div.2-yr) at LTS with a maximum of 12 credits be exempted.

Program Content

(course credits in brackets)

 

i) Core Courses

 SW2000 Paths of Prayer (3)

 SW2027/PT2062 Spirituality Workshop and Silent Retreat (3)

 SW2029 Ignatian Spirituality and Discernment (3)

 

ii) Guided Electives on Christian Spirituality (SW)

3 courses (9)

 

iii) Free Electives

2 courses (6)
